To complete the pilgrimage, Muslims shed all signs of … WebMay 30, 2024 · Day 2: The day of Arafah — Dhu Al Hijjah 9. Known as the day of Arafah — a pivotal day of Hajj. After the Fajr prayer in Mina, pilgrims make the journey to Mount Arafat, a 70-metre hill believed to be where the Prophet Mohammed gave his final sermon. Standing and praying on Mount Arafat is considered the peak of the pilgrimage. WebSep 3, 2024 · Rituals Of Hajj. The major Muslim pilgrimage to Mecca needs a minimum of six days to complete. Key rituals that all pilgrims must perform during Hajj are: Day 1: Pilgrims walk from Mecca to Mina and spend the day in camps making Salah, listening to lectures and reciting Talbiyah. WebJan 31, 2013 · Before going on Hajj they make special preparations including making sure that their family is taken care of whilst they are away and preparing themselves spiritually. Packing for Hajj is very different from packing to go on holiday. One important thing they will take is a ihram for men this is two white, unsewn pieces of cloth.

WebJul 20, 2024 · During the first stage of Hajj, Muslims walk around the Ka'bah in an anti-clockwise direction seven times. This is known as Tawaf and is done to show that all Muslims are equal.
